1. Start with a Plan:
Before diving into decluttering, it’s important to create a plan of action. Assess each room, identifying the areas that need the most attention. Prioritize which spaces to tackle first based on your specific needs. By having a well-thought-out plan, you ensure a more efficient and organized approach to the task.

2. Declutter in Categories:
To avoid feeling overwhelmed and maximize efficiency, decluttering by categories is key. Start with the easiest categories, such as clothing or books, and gradually move on to more sentimental items like photographs or heirlooms. This method allows you to focus on one area at a time and make more informed decisions about what to keep, donate, or discard.

3. Create a System:
Establishing a system for organizing your belongings will make it easier to maintain a clutter-free home in the long run. Invest in storage solutions that suit your needs, such as labeled bins, storage cabinets, or floating shelves. Designate specific spots for frequently used items, allowing for quick access and easy retrieval.

4. Purge Unnecessary Items:
As you declutter, be ruthless in letting go of items that no longer serve a purpose or bring you joy. Ask yourself questions like, “Have I used this in the past year?” or “Does this item hold significant sentimental value?” Be mindful of your emotions, but also realistic about the space constraints in your home. Remember, decluttering is about creating space for the things that truly matter.

5. Optimize Small Spaces:
Not every home is blessed with abundant storage space, but that doesn’t mean you can’t make the most of what you have. Find creative solutions to maximize storage in small areas, such as utilizing vertical space, installing hooks or racks on walls, or investing in furniture with built-in storage compartments. Effective utilization of small spaces is key in maintaining an organized home.

6. Establish Daily Habits:
Once you have successfully decluttered and organized your home, it’s essential to establish daily habits to prevent clutter from piling up again. Set aside a few minutes each day to tidy up, put things back in their designated spots, and avoid accumulating unnecessary items. Small daily actions will help maintain a clutter-free home environment over time.

7. Seek Professional Help if Needed:
If home organization and decluttering continue to feel overwhelming, don’t hesitate to seek professional assistance. Professional organizers can provide valuable insights and personalized solutions tailored to your home and specific needs. They can offer expert advice on space optimization and efficient decluttering techniques, ensuring an organized home that suits your lifestyle.
